It seems unlikely that someone would replace a valid Boston Whaler HIN with a HIN from a defunct manufacturer -- that would be a great way to diminish the value of the boat. Unless there were some illegal doings at some point in the past, my hunch is that this boat is one of the many Whaler copy-cat models that were available in the 1960-1970 time period. The HIN does not even follow any of the usual formats, making me think it was not manufactured in North America.

Nice looking boat, but not a Boston Whaler.

My two cents, I know the 15 hull intimately. It has the forward smirk junction flaw. And only Boston Whaler would use the brass drain tubes, and they are in the correct positions. So my opinion is either one of two possible options: 1. It is a 15 sport, that was stolen and laundered or 2. Some one used a Boston Whaler mold to make a boat which is not likely. I currently own two whalers and a wahoo! It's not a wahoo! It is a Whaler, and I'll bet on it.

top2bottom wrote:
Eduardono E15BOX is on that plate


I think you have your answer there. The E15BOX must be an out-of-production Eduardono model, no longer shown on their website. Maybe Whaler complained, or maybe it was an authorized reproduction and the agreement ended.

But in any case, it's not a Boston Whaler. However, it may be such a close copy that for practical purposes you won't notice a difference. Enjoy the boat -- it looks to be in nice shape and ready for some fun!
